STATE EX REL. BARTON v. HUMAN

No. 36053.

514 S.W.2d 100 (1974)

STATE ex rel. Rosemary Jean BARTON et al., Relators, Rosemary Jean Barton, Plaintiff-Appellant, v. F. William HUMAN, Jr., et al., Respondents, St. Louis County, Intervenor, Respondent.

Missouri Court of Appeals, St. Louis District, Division Two.

September 10, 1974.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Benjamin Roth, St. Louis, for plaintiff-appellant.

Lewis, Rice, Tucker, Allen & Chubb, Frank P. Wolff, Jr., F. William McCalpin, St. Louis, for respondents.

Thomas W. Wehrle, Morton I. Golder, George W. Lang, II, Clayton, for intervenor.


SMITH, Presiding Judge.

Relator appeals from a judgment of the Circuit Court of St. Louis County quashing an alternative writ of mandamus against respondents, the members of the Board of Election Commissioners of St. Louis County. We affirm.
